Vue Element Admin 是一个基于 Vue.js 和 Element UI 的后台前端解决方案。具体来说,它是一个用于构建后台管理系统的模板和框架,具有以下核心特点:1、高效的开发工具,2、丰富的组件库,3、强大的功能模块。这种解决方案不仅帮助开发者快速构建出功能全面的管理系统,还能提高开发效率和代码质量。
一、VUE ELEMENT ADMIN 的核心特点
- 高效的开发工具
Vue Element Admin 集成了多种开发工具和插件,如 Vue Router、Vuex、ESLint 等。这些工具可以帮助开发者快速搭建项目框架,提高代码规范性和可维护性。
- 丰富的组件库
Element UI 是一个基于 Vue.js 的组件库,提供了许多高质量的 UI 组件,如表格、表单、按钮、对话框等。开发者可以直接使用这些组件,快速构建出美观、实用的界面。
- 强大的功能模块
Vue Element Admin 提供了许多常见的后台功能模块,如用户管理、权限管理、数据展示、图表分析等。这些模块经过优化和封装,可以直接使用或根据需求进行自定义开发。
二、VUE ELEMENT ADMIN 的优势
- 易于上手
Vue.js 和 Element UI 都有详细的文档和教程,开发者可以通过这些资源快速掌握 Vue Element Admin 的使用方法。同时,Vue Element Admin 提供了完整的项目结构和示例代码,开发者可以直接参考和学习。
- 高效开发
通过使用 Vue Element Admin,开发者可以快速搭建出一个功能全面的后台管理系统。这不仅节省了开发时间,还提高了开发效率。此外,Vue Element Admin 提供了许多优化和性能提升的技术,如异步加载、懒加载等,使得系统运行更加流畅。
- 灵活扩展
Vue Element Admin 提供了许多可扩展的功能和配置项,开发者可以根据需求进行自定义开发。例如,可以根据业务需求添加新的功能模块或修改现有模块的逻辑和样式。同时,Vue Element Admin 还支持第三方插件的集成,如 ECharts、D3.js 等,可以进一步增强系统的功能和表现力。
三、VUE ELEMENT ADMIN 的使用场景
- 企业后台管理系统
Vue Element Admin 提供了许多常见的后台管理功能,如用户管理、权限管理、数据展示等,非常适合用于构建企业级的后台管理系统。通过使用 Vue Element Admin,企业可以快速搭建出一个高效、稳定、美观的管理平台,提高工作效率和管理水平。
- 数据分析系统
Vue Element Admin 支持多种数据展示和分析方式,如表格、图表、报表等,适合用于构建数据分析系统。通过使用 Vue Element Admin,企业可以对业务数据进行全面的分析和展示,帮助决策者做出科学、准确的判断。
- SaaS 平台
Vue Element Admin 提供了丰富的组件库和功能模块,非常适合用于构建 SaaS 平台。通过使用 Vue Element Admin,开发者可以快速搭建出一个功能全面、性能优越的 SaaS 平台,满足用户多样化的需求。
四、如何快速上手 VUE ELEMENT ADMIN
- 安装和配置
首先,开发者需要安装 Node.js 和 npm,然后使用 Vue CLI 创建一个新的 Vue 项目。接着,按照 Vue Element Admin 的文档和教程,安装和配置相关的依赖和插件,如 Vue Router、Vuex、Element UI 等。
- 学习文档和示例代码
Vue Element Admin 提供了详细的文档和示例代码,开发者可以通过阅读文档和查看示例代码,快速掌握 Vue Element Admin 的使用方法和技巧。同时,开发者还可以通过 GitHub 等平台,获取更多的资源和支持。
- 实践和应用
在掌握了基本的使用方法后,开发者可以根据实际需求,开始构建自己的后台管理系统。通过实践和应用,开发者可以不断积累经验和提高技能,最终掌握 Vue Element Admin 的使用和开发。
五、VUE ELEMENT ADMIN 的最佳实践
- 代码规范和风格
在使用 Vue Element Admin 进行开发时,建议遵循统一的代码规范和风格,如使用 ESLint 进行代码检查和格式化。这不仅可以提高代码的可读性和可维护性,还可以减少代码错误和漏洞。
- 模块化和组件化
在开发过程中,建议将功能模块和 UI 组件进行拆分和封装,形成独立的模块和组件。这样可以提高代码的复用性和可维护性,同时也有助于团队协作和开发效率。
- 性能优化和监控
在构建后台管理系统时,建议关注系统的性能和稳定性,采用异步加载、懒加载等技术进行性能优化。同时,可以使用监控工具,如 Sentry、New Relic 等,对系统进行实时监控和分析,及时发现和解决问题。
六、VUE ELEMENT ADMIN 的未来发展
- 社区和生态
Vue Element Admin 拥有活跃的社区和丰富的生态系统,开发者可以通过参与社区活动、提交 PR 和 Issue 等方式,贡献自己的力量。同时,随着 Vue.js 和 Element UI 的不断发展和更新,Vue Element Admin 也将不断优化和完善,提供更好的用户体验和开发支持。
- 技术创新和应用
随着前端技术的不断创新和发展,Vue Element Admin 也将不断引入新的技术和工具,如 Vue 3、Composition API、TypeScript 等。这将进一步提升 Vue Element Admin 的功能和性能,满足更多样化的需求和应用场景。
- 行业应用和推广
Vue Element Admin 在企业后台管理系统、数据分析系统、SaaS 平台等多个领域具有广泛的应用前景。未来,随着更多企业和开发者的使用和推广,Vue Element Admin 将成为构建后台管理系统的首选方案,为更多用户带来高效、稳定、美观的解决方案。
总结
Vue Element Admin 是一个基于 Vue.js 和 Element UI 的后台前端解决方案,具有高效的开发工具、丰富的组件库和强大的功能模块等核心特点。通过使用 Vue Element Admin,开发者可以快速构建出功能全面、性能优越的后台管理系统。未来,随着社区和生态的发展、技术的创新和应用,Vue Element Admin 将在更多领域和场景中发挥重要作用。建议开发者深入学习和掌握 Vue Element Admin,并在实际项目中应用和实践,提升开发效率和项目质量。
相关问答FAQs:
1. Vue Element Admin是什么?
Vue Element Admin是一个开源的后台管理系统模板,基于Vue.js和Element UI开发。它提供了一套完整的解决方案,用于快速构建现代化的响应式后台管理系统。Vue Element Admin具有可扩展性、灵活性和易用性,可以帮助开发者快速搭建功能丰富的后台管理系统。
2. Vue Element Admin有哪些主要特点和功能?
- 响应式布局:Vue Element Admin采用了响应式设计,可以在不同设备上自动适应,提供了更好的用户体验。
- 多样化的主题:Vue Element Admin提供了多个主题样式,开发者可以根据需求选择适合自己的主题风格。
- 强大的权限管理:Vue Element Admin内置了权限管理系统,可以轻松实现用户权限控制和角色管理,保证系统的安全性。
- 快速开发:Vue Element Admin提供了丰富的组件和工具,可以快速搭建页面和表单,提高开发效率。
- 数据可视化:Vue Element Admin支持数据可视化展示,提供了图表、报表等功能,帮助开发者更好地理解和分析数据。
- 插件丰富:Vue Element Admin支持插件扩展,可以根据需求添加各种插件,满足不同的业务需求。
3. 如何使用Vue Element Admin来构建后台管理系统?
使用Vue Element Admin构建后台管理系统可以分为以下几个步骤:
- 确保你已经安装了Node.js和npm,并且已经创建了一个新的项目目录。
- 在项目目录下打开终端,运行以下命令来安装Vue Element Admin:
npm install vue-element-admin
- 安装完成后,进入项目目录,运行以下命令来启动开发服务器:
npm run dev
- 在浏览器中打开
http://localhost:9528
,你将看到Vue Element Admin的登录页面。 - 使用默认的用户名和密码(admin/admin)登录系统,你将被重定向到后台管理页面。
- 在后台管理页面中,你可以根据需要进行菜单配置、权限管理、用户管理等操作,以满足你的业务需求。
- 根据项目需求,你可以自定义页面和组件,添加业务逻辑,完善后台管理系统。
以上是关于Vue Element Admin的简要介绍和使用方法,希望对你有所帮助!
文章标题:vue element admin是什么,发布者:飞飞,转载请注明出处:https://worktile.com/kb/p/3561972